Flutist Sofia Cormack selected for Spring semester internship with IAWM

Flutist Sofia Cormack has been selected for an internship with the International Alliance for Women in Music (IAWM) during the spring 2024 semester. The remote paid position will include mentorship from IAWM Board members while gaining valuable experience in the various aspects of non-profit management, development, marketing, and advocacy.

The IAWM was formed in 1995 through the merger of three organizations that arose during the women’s rights movements of the 1970s to combat inequitable treatment of women-in-music: the International League of Women Composers founded in 1975 to create and expand opportunities for women composers of music; the International Congress on Women in Music founded in 1979 to form an organizational basis for women in music conferences and meetings; and American Women Composers, Inc., founded in 1976 to promote music by American women composers. A native of Omaha, Sofia earned her Bachelor of Music degree in flute performance from UNO in 2021. She is currently a second year graduate student at UNO studying with Dr. Christine Beard and will complete her Master of Music degree in flute performance in May 2024.
